public class ActivateGovernanceActivity<I,F extends Enum<F>> extends AbstractGovernanceActivity<I,F,GovernanceControl<I,F>>
Task
to activate the Governance
.governanceControl
Constructor and Description |
---|
ActivateGovernanceActivity(GovernanceMetaData<I,F> metaData,
GovernanceControl<I,F> governanceControl)
Initiate.
|
Modifier and Type | Method and Description |
---|---|
boolean |
doActivity(GovernanceContext<F> governanceContext,
JobContext jobContext,
JobNode jobNode,
JobNodeActivateSet activateSet,
TeamIdentifier currentTeam,
ContainerContext containerContext)
Undertakes an activity regarding the
Governance . |
getGovernanceMetaData
public ActivateGovernanceActivity(GovernanceMetaData<I,F> metaData, GovernanceControl<I,F> governanceControl)
metaData
- GovernanceMetaData
.governanceControl
- GovernanceControl
.public boolean doActivity(GovernanceContext<F> governanceContext, JobContext jobContext, JobNode jobNode, JobNodeActivateSet activateSet, TeamIdentifier currentTeam, ContainerContext containerContext) throws Throwable
GovernanceActivity
Governance
.governanceContext
- GovernanceContext
jobContext
- JobContext
.jobNode
- JobNode
.activateSet
- JobNodeActivateSet
.currentTeam
- TeamIdentifier
of the current Team
undertaking
the activity.containerContext
- ContainerContext
.true
should activity be successfully trigger. In
other words, does not need re-executing as waiting on
ManagedObject
.Throwable
- If activity fails.Copyright © 2005–2016. All rights reserved.